Transaction 90a5e587303bedcfdb4767ebd08968f33ec733fc78020d56a6d9c72d07baa08b
1 Input
1 Output
-
90a5e587303bedcfdb4767ebd08968f33ec733fc78020d56a6d9c72d07baa08b:0
- value
- 174314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 571fef9983f8643d291189c791057f17b76dcecd OP_EQUAL
- address
- 39dgyBSHxXn7retzHuQoULd688avEzqKWE